The purpose of the Activity is to strengthen key elements of Ugandan health systems focusing on health care financing (HCF), human resources for health (HRH), health management information systems (HMIS) and community health systems.

Advancing food fortification in Haiti to improve the nutritional status of Haitians, with a focus on maternal and child nutrition, by: enhancing the availability of fortified food through the private sector; supporting Government of Haiti to monitor fortification; and improving the availability, access to and acceptance of safe quality complementary food for families with infants and young children.

This activity will support the three tiers of governments to improve the health system, especially around improved governance, improved demand-side barriers and accountability of communities in the health system, and improved quality of health care services at the facility and community level. The activity will focus on improving quality of care for maternal newborn and family planning services, prioritizing marginalized communities. The support will complement the USAID Health Direct Financing Project, improve readiness of health facilities and prepare the health system for the possible future health emergencies with increased coordination across three tiers of government.

Among other solutions, this award aims to make it easier for USAID staff to fund impact evaluations and understand evidence, so that they can answer questions about program direction and management with the best tools available to social science. The purpose of the proposed Evidence for Cost-Effectiveness (ECE) activity is to:
Integrate existing, relevant evidence from high-quality evaluations into USAID activity designs; and
integrate high-quality, randomized evaluations into USAID activity designs by providing a platform for academics from the social and behavioral sciences to engage with USAID design teams. The evidence resulting from impact evaluations
(1) helps to strengthen the Agency’s current and future programming by understanding the causal impact per dollar of its programs; and
(2) produces a public good in the form of high-quality contributions to the global evidence base that can improve policy and programming of other development partners.

The Community Health & Social Behavior Change Activity aims to improve the utilization of high-quality community health services in three regions in Saint-Louis, Matam, and Louga by: 1) improving the quality of community health services; 2) increasing preventive and care-seeking behaviors for maternal, newborn, and child health, family planning, nutrition, and zoonotic diseases; and 3) improving leadership, management, governance of community health.

The purpose of the USAID/Mali Cross-Sectoral Youth Activity is to enable vulnerable and marginalized 15-29 year-old Mailan youth to become educated, healthy, and productive citizens while building their resilience to recurrent crises. The USAID/Mali Cross-Sectoral Youth Activity will focus on an integrated program that includes basic education, workforce development, media literacy to counter disinformation, youth entrepreneurship, and reproductive health. A phased exit plan should be forecasted and a sustainability strategy developed with activity partners.

This new activity will help Burundian women secure access and rights to land and strengthen their economic empowerment. This work will include land documentation and training on entrepreneurship and climate-smart agriculture, to increase financial independence and resilience to climate change. The activity will partner with local actors, including the private sector, to strengthen women farmers’ participation in market-driven enterprises and build their entrepreneurial, leadership and management skills to achieve greater economic independence.
